        • Re: Bajaj Dominar 400 Ownership Experience Thread

          BP speed vs normal petrol for dominar experience : Bike cold start sounds like irregular firing on some days. Bike rides heavier, can feel it when twisting throttle, there is more engine braking, seems like slightly greater torque. On regular petrol, engine feels free, lesser engine braking.
          When both grades are supposed to be Octane 91, i feel quite a big difference.
          Am planning to try 400 regular + rest speed. Anyone else see a difference.

                • Re: Bajaj Dominar 400 Ownership Experience Thread

                  Originally posted by n1tesh View Post
                  I think Regular petrol from BP are not 91 Octane.
                  All regular fuel sold in India is minimum 91 octane.
                  Speed is normal fuel + additive (Examples of additives are System G/ Adon P etc.. BP might have their own additive blend)
                  Speed 97 is the higher octane fuel, and not easily available.
